What Are Hidden Costs in Solar Installation?

Hidden costs are expenses not clearly mentioned in the initial quotation. Some dealers advertise a low price but add charges later during installation or documentation.

Knowing the hidden costs in solar installation helps you avoid confusion and choose the right solar company.

Hidden Costs In Solar Installation

Hidden Cost #1: Mounting Structure & Roof Work

Extra Charges for Roof Compatibility

Not all rooftops are the same. If your roof needs reinforcement or a custom structure, extra steel and labor may be required. These charges are often not included in the first quote.


Hidden Cost #2: Electrical & Safety Upgrades

Wiring, Earthing, and Protection Devices

Many homes require:

  • New DC and AC wiring
  • Additional earthing pits
  • MCBs, SPD, or lightning arrestors

If your dealer does not inspect the site properly, these become hidden costs in solar installation later.


Hidden Cost #3: Net Metering & Government Process

Application and Follow-ups

Net metering is mandatory for on-grid solar systems. Some installers charge separately for documentation, utility visits, and approvals. To understand what should be included, explore Government Solar Schemes and avoid paying unnecessary fees.


Hidden Cost #4: Maintenance & Cleaning

AMC Not Included

Solar panels need periodic cleaning and system checks. If Annual Maintenance Contract (AMC) is not part of your package, you may pay extra every year. This long-term expense is one of the most ignored hidden costs in solar installation.


Hidden Cost #5: Low-Quality Components

Cheap Inverters and Local Accessories

Some dealers cut costs by using:

  • Low-grade inverters
  • Substandard cables
  • Poor mounting hardware

These components fail early and increase repair costs. Many of these issues are discussed in Solar Installation Mistakes, which every buyer should read.


Hidden Cost #6: Warranty Confusion

Incomplete Coverage

Customers often assume full warranty, but:

  • Installation warranty is limited
  • Inverter and panel warranties differ
  • Service response may not be included
